The first black man to win a supporter Oscar for his role in the film “An Officer and a Gentleman” has died.
Louis Gossett Junior previously won an Emmy for his role in the groundbreaking TV mini-series “Roots”.
He was also a star on Broadway, replacing Billy Daniels in “Golden Boy” with Sammy Davis Junior in 1964, and more recently in the 2023 remake of “The Colour Purple.”
No cause of death was revealed. Gossett Junior was 87.
